3D 탱크 HTML5 게임

요약

HTML5, CSS3, JavaScript로 만든 3D 탱크 게임으로 데스크탑과 모바일 지원.

프롬프트

HTML5, CSS3, JavaScript를 사용하여 3D 탱크 게임을 만드세요.

플랫폼 및 기술
- 외부 프레임워크 없이 HTML5, CSS3, JavaScript (ES6+)로 개발하여 데스크탑과 모바일에서 원활하게 실행되도록 합니다.
- 터치 컨트롤과 키보드/마우스 지원을 함께 구현하여 사용자 경험을 극대화하세요.

기능
- 직관적인 컨트롤 시스템과 튜토리얼 힌트를 설계하여 플레이어를 안내합니다.
- 점진적으로 난이도가 증가하는 레벨 시스템, localStorage를 활용한 진행 상황 저장, 점수 및 업적 시스템을 포함합니다.

시각 및 음향 요소
- 일관되고 매력적인 사용자 인터페이스를 제작합니다.
- 애니메이션을 통해 반응성을 개선하고 피드백을 제공합니다.
- 효과음과 배경음악을 추가하며, 음소거 옵션을 제공합니다.

성능 및 최적화
- 모든 기기에서 안정적인 FPS와 빠른 반응 속도를 보장하도록 최적화하세요.
- 효율적인 알고리즘을 사용하여 자원 소비를 최소화하고 빠른 로딩을 구현합니다.

사용자 경험
- 게임 시작 시 명확하게 게임 지침과 목표를 제시합니다.
- 긍정적인 시각 및 청각 피드백을 활용하여 플레이어 동기를 부여합니다.
- 균형 잡힌 난이도 설계로 플레이어의 흥미를 유지합니다.

추가 사항
- 모든 CSS와 JavaScript 코드를 하나의 HTML 파일 내에 통합하여 간결하고 읽기 쉬운 코드를 작성합니다.
- 게임 컨트롤과 메커니즘을 파일 시작 부분에 문서화합니다.
- 다양한 화면 크기에 맞게 반응형 디자인을 구현합니다.

원본 프롬프트

# Задание: создай игру "танки 3D"

## Требования к игре:
1. **Платформа и технологии:**
   - Использовать HTML5, CSS3 и JavaScript (ES6+) без внешних фреймворков
   - Обеспечить работу на настольных и мобильных устройствах
   - Поддержка сенсорного управления и клавиатуры/мыши

2. **Функциональность:**
   - Интуитивно понятное управление с обучающими подсказками
   - Прогрессивная сложность и система уровней
   - Сохранение прогресса в localStorage
   - Система очков и достижений

3. **Визуальные и аудио элементы:**
   - Привлекательный и согласованный пользовательский интерфейс
   - Анимации для обеспечения отзывчивости и обратной связи
   - Звуковые эффекты и фоновая музыка с возможностью отключения

4. **Производительность и оптимизация:**
   - Оптимизированная производительность с стабильным FPS
   - Эффективные алгоритмы для обработки игровой логики
   - Минимизация потребления ресурсов и отзывчивость управления

5. **Пользовательский опыт:**
   - Четкие инструкции и цели игры
   - Положительное подкрепление через визуальные и звуковые эффекты
   - Сбалансированная кривая сложности для поддержания интереса

## Дополнительные детали:
- Создайте компактный код с встроенными ресурсами
- Обеспечьте отладку и обработку ошибок для стабильной работы
- Комментируйте код для будущих модификаций
- Реализуйте адаптивный дизайн для различных устройств

## Структура ответа:
1. Предоставьте полный HTML-файл, готовый к запуску
2. Включите все CSS и JavaScript непосредственно в HTML
3. Документируйте управление и механику игры в начале файла

Q: Какой игровой процесс вы хотите реализовать?
A: rpg

Q: Как должны вести себя противники в игре?
A: догонять и стрелять

생성 비용 요약

모델 이름: claude-3-7-sonnet-latest

응답 시간: 317.77 sec.

결과 토큰: 26,554

비용: $0.40151700